Technology for the automotive future


Electronic Power Steering (EPS) has seen increased adoption over hydraulic power steering in recent years, with most new


cars now being equipped with EPS. Shifting towards electrification eliminates the need for a power steering pump, reducing


the weight and reducing the overall fuel consumption by around 3%.


EPS also provides better driveability and performance by adjusting the torque via software based on vehicle speed, gener-


ating active torque when needed to improve vehicle safety. And additional driver support features such as lane and parking


assist are possible by expanding the EPS functionality.


EPS is achieved by detecting the steering position via a torque sensor, and the with motor is driven using a gate driver and


power transistor combination (see block diagram below). For controlling, motor feedback is used, the position and torque


output of the motor are adjusted based on the supply current to the motor.
